    Company Overview:

    Grocery Connect, an initiative by Bonton Farms, is reshaping the landscape of grocery access in underserved communities. Our non-traditional approach brings grocery shopping to the heart of neighborhoods, offering online ordering and pickup services at our centers powered by our grocery partners advanced platform. Grocery Connect is currently in a proof of concept and pilot process, and we are seeking an experienced and innovative leader to join our team as the Director of Grocery Connect.

    What is Bonton?

    For the last 200 years, racial injustice and systemic oppression prevented opportunities in Bonton that were a given elsewhere. People here experienced higher rates of diabetes, stroke and cancer, and 48% of residents lived in poverty. Residents have been denied access to the seven human essentials that are necessary to survive and thrive - health & wellness, economic stability, safe and affordable housing, transportation, a sense of belonging, education and access to fair credit. Today, the community is transforming, and healing is coming from within.

    Who We Are

    Bonton Farms is on a mission is to transform lives by disrupting systems of inequity, laying a foundation where health, wholeness, and opportunity are the norm for all people. While many nonprofits work to solve one issue, Bonton Farms focuses on place-based interventions to build community capacity for long-term change. As the ecosystem of community resources improves, the neighbors in Bonton use these resources to build successful, self-sufficient lives, ultimately interrupting the impact of decades of disenfranchisement. Bonton Farms’ programs focus on the following seven human essentials: economic stability, health and wellness, transportation, education, access to fair credit and community belonging.
